This book, which takes the employees' perspective, illustrates what works and what doesn't work to engage, involve, and motivate a workforce. Through examples, it shows how the "engage" methodology links to the Lean Process. While focusing on the softer/"people" part of Lean, it maximizes the value returned on the organization's investment in Lean. It links "engagement" to measurable performance improvements. The how-to book includes a methodology overview and details on how to implement including communication do's and don'ts as well as a checklist for leader standard work (a tool for individual leaders to track and be recognized for their "engage, involve, and motivate" behaviors).
